  script_tag(name:"insight", value:"a. VMware ESXi and ESX NFC NULL pointer dereference

VMware ESXi and ESX contain a NULL pointer dereference in the handling
of the Network File Copy (NFC) traffic. To exploit this vulnerability,
an attacker must intercept and modify the NFC traffic between
ESXi/ESX and the client. Exploitation of the issue may lead to a
Denial of Service.

To reduce the likelihood of exploitation, vSphere components should be
deployed on an isolated management network.

b. VMware VMX process denial of service vulnerability

Due to a flaw in the handling of invalid ports, it is possible to
cause the VMX process to fail. This vulnerability may allow a guest
user to affect the VMX process resulting in a partial denial of
service on the host.");
  script_tag(name:"solution", value:"Apply the missing patch(es).");
  script_tag(name:"summary", value:"VMware ESXi address several security issues.");
  script_tag(name:"affected", value:"- VMware ESXi 5.1 Build < 1483097

  - VMware ESXi 5.0 Build < 1311177");
